What does “unfocused” mean?

The word “unfocused” means lacking a clear aim, direction, or concentration. In plain terms, lacking clear direction or concentration, or (of an image) blurry.

How do you use “unfocused” in a sentence?

Here is “unfocused” used in a sentence: “The meeting was unfocused and drifted from topic to topic.”

What part of speech is “unfocused”?

“Unfocused” is an adjective.

How many meanings does “unfocused” have?

“Unfocused” has 2 distinct senses listed in this dictionary. The most common is: lacking a clear aim, direction, or concentration.
